    Windows 10 Version 20H2 Upgrade Problem [Resolved]


    I decided to install the 20H2 upgrade on my 2 PCs this morning. Both were running version 2004. All went fine on my laptop, but I'm left with a problem on my desktop PC.

    The upgrade appeared to complete normally as shown in the specs (see screenshot) however I was left with another problem. When I go to Start --> Power, I see two additional options - "Update and shut down" and "Update and restart." I have tried both but neither correct the problem. Also, if I try to check for Windows Updates, the window just sits in an endless loop and never completes. Other than this problem, the PC seems to functions normally.

    Any idea how to fix this?

    I lost all thumbnails for audio & video files, it broke double click, copy & paste (works sometimes, usually on the second try)
    The usual fix: Go to View - Properties "always show icons never thumbnails was already unchecked.
    Then I discovered that Win Update had removed some of the standard Win 10 codecs, so I downloaded a free basic codec pack which fixed the thumbnail problem instantly. Then I discovered that Win Update had deleted the Layout.ini file in the Prefetch folder.
    I used Command prompt :-
    Rundll32.exe advapi32.dll,ProcessIdleTasks
    to rebuild the layout.ini file, and it even works if it has been completely deleted from the prefetch folder.
    Now, all folder opening speed and other things have picked up big time..
